The family of Keith Siegel, a Chapel Hill man held hostage by Hamas for over a year, spoke to the public Monday for the first time since her husband's release.
American-Israeli Keith Siegel, 2 other hostages released in Gaza in 3rd exchange of Israel-Hamas ceasefire
It is believed that at least two of the six American hostages still held in Gaza are alive — Sagui Dekel-Chen, 35, who grew up in Bloomfield, Connecticut, and Edan Alexander, 19, from Tenafly, New Jersey. Four other Americans are believed to have been killed in captivity.

Hamas frees American-Israeli Keith Siegel, 2 others for 187 prisoners
Hamas militants on Saturday released three hostages, including Keith Siegel, the first American-Israeli dual national freed during the cease-fire in exchange for 183 Palestinian prisoners.
